To solve the expression [tex]\( 13.1 - 20.2 + 9 - (-38.5) \)[/tex], we need to break it down step by step:
1. Identify and simplify the subtraction of a negative number:
- The expression [tex]\(-(-38.5)\)[/tex] is equivalent to adding [tex]\(38.5\)[/tex], because subtracting a negative is the same as addition.
2. Rewrite the expression with this simplification:
- The expression now becomes [tex]\( 13.1 - 20.2 + 9 + 38.5\)[/tex].
3. Perform the operations from left to right:
a. Subtract [tex]\(20.2\)[/tex] from [tex]\(13.1\)[/tex]:
- [tex]\(13.1 - 20.2 = -7.1\)[/tex]
b. Add [tex]\(9\)[/tex] to the result:
- [tex]\(-7.1 + 9 = 1.9\)[/tex]
c. Finally, add [tex]\(38.5\)[/tex] to the result:
- [tex]\(1.9 + 38.5 = 40.4\)[/tex]
Therefore, the final result of the expression is [tex]\(40.4\)[/tex].
